Review: The Cleveland Show “Die Semi-Hard”

To help pass time while posing in a holiday nativity scene, Cleveland tells his version of one of his favorite holiday stories: “Die Hard.” In it, terrorists target Waterman Cable on Christmas Eve. Guest voices include John Slattery as Mayor Box.

The year was 1988…and this is the Cleveland Show’s first parody! It’s a Die Hard parody, and if you know the movie, Cleveland is John McClane, Rallo is Argyle, Tim the Bear is Hans, Colt is Harry Ellis, and Donna is Holly Gennaro with the rest of the cast are terrorists with the exception of Junior and Roberta who are both police officers, the former playing the more important role of Al Powell.

If you don’t know the plot of Die Hard, a bunch of Russian terrorists take over Nakatomi Tower to break into a vault, and steal a couple hundred million dollars worth in negotiable bonds. All the popular scenes are here too, the opening airport scene, the Harry snorting coke routine, and the walking on broken glass routine.

Our Take

The episode plays out pretty similar to the Family Guy-Star Wars parodies where they take the basic premise of the movies and have all the parts played by the main characters, and when they run out they use recurring ones(Consuela as the maid was a nice touch), but this episode didn’t even mention why the terrorists were there until the end which in Die Hard you pretty much know from the beginning what they are after. Also, the Star Wars-Family Guy episodes had a chock-full of jokes to go along with the episodes, and this didn’t really have that, the only one that I liked was the “Scooby-Doo motherfucker” line.
